System Compatibility and Application

In a fully integrated Rockwell Automation maintenance planning system, the 2711P-K10C4A8 acts as the human touchpoint that bridges the gap between high-level SCADA data and floor-level machine control. When paired with a ControlLogix L73 PLC as the central processing unit, the keypad module allows operators to directly interact with logic programs that govern energy-intensive processes such as conveyor speed ramping, pump scheduling, and compressor load cycling.

On the drive side, the PowerFlex 755 AC drive is one of the most commonly integrated components in operational-efficiency retrofits. The 2711P-K10C4A8 can display real-time frequency output, motor current draw, and fault codes from the PowerFlex 755, enabling operators to identify inefficient operating points and adjust speed references without navigating to a separate drive keypad. Similarly, when a PowerFlex 525 compact drive is deployed on smaller motor loads such as fans or small conveyors, the HMI keypad provides a unified interface that eliminates the need for multiple local control panels — reducing both unplanned downtime from manual overrides and the risk of operator error.

For energy metering and power quality monitoring, the PowerMonitor 5000 unit provides granular data on active power, reactive power, power factor, and harmonic distortion. This data is passed via EtherNet/IP to the ControlLogix PLC and can be surfaced on the 2711P-K10C4A8 display, giving line operators immediate visibility into whether a production cell is operating within its energy budget. When power factor drops below threshold, operators can trigger capacitor bank switching or adjust drive output frequency directly from the keypad — a capability that significantly reduces reactive energy penalties on industrial electricity tariffs.

The 1756-EN2T EtherNet/IP communication module within the ControlLogix chassis ensures that all data — from drive status to energy meter readings — flows reliably across the plant network. The 2711P-K10C4A8 connects to this network backbone, pulling live tag data and pushing operator commands with minimal latency. For plants using a distributed I/O architecture, the 1734 POINT I/O modules collect discrete and analog signals from field sensors, feeding process variables such as motor temperature, vibration amplitude, and flow rate into the PLC program. These variables are then displayed on the HMI keypad, enabling condition-based control decisions that prevent unplanned downtime from running equipment beyond its optimal operating range.

In facilities where legacy equipment is still in operation, the 1747-L553 SLC 5/05 PLC may serve as a sub-controller for older production lines. The 2711P-K10C4A8 can be configured to communicate with SLC platforms via DH+ or EtherNet/IP bridging, providing a modern operator interface for legacy systems without requiring a full controls upgrade. This hybrid architecture is particularly valuable in energy retrofit projects where the goal is to add monitoring and control capability to existing equipment at minimal capital cost.

Q3: Can this HMI keypad replace a faulty 2711P-K10C4A8 without reprogramming?
In most cases, yes. The application program resides on the PanelView Plus terminal, not the keypad module itself. Replacing a faulty 2711P-K10C4A8 keypad with a new unit of the same part number typically requires no reprogramming, making it a straightforward like-for-like replacement that minimizes downtime.
